We also use high-quality raw materials that comply with the designated standards to produce clinker, which is the main component of cement. These materials undergo intense monitoring by the quality control department and multiple tests to ensure their conformity with the required specifications. The five main materials include:
Limestone: the primary component of clinker, sourced from our quarries that guarantee its purity, quality and stability of its chemical and physical properties.
Marl: we possess one of the best marl quarries known for its high quality and stable properties.
Gypsum: we have a gypsum quarry with high purity, as this material is a major component of cement and has a significant impact on the quality of cement types.
Pozzolana: a natural material that enhances the properties and quality of cement. We have a special quarry for this material, where the materials possess high efficiency and distinguished quality.
Additional raw materials such as iron ore and bauxite, which are used to improve the product and meet the diverse requirements of our customers.

Cement for Finishing is a special and innovative product that has been specifically developed to meet the requirements of the Saudi market for finishing works, decorations, and brick manufacturing facilities. It stands out for its high smoothness, which aids in achieving a sleek and refined surface. It conforms to ASTM C1157 Type GU, in accordance with American specifications. One of its distinguishing features is its lighter color compared to regular Portland cement, making it well-suited for decorative and architectural projects, as well as various finishing works. The production of this versatile Finishing Cement is recognized as an environmentally friendly solution, known as Green Cement, due to its low carbon emissions during the manufacturing process. This positively impacts the surrounding environment. Additionally, it possesses exceptional qualities when compared to regular Portland cement, surpassing it in terms of both quality and performance.

This type of cement is produced according to Gulf Standard GSO 1914/2009 (E) and American Standard ASTM C150 Type V. It is used in places where concrete is in contact with soil, groundwater, seawater or exposed to coastal areas where the concrete is exposed to high levels of sulfates that can damage the structure.
